Robots in Social Media, Why Is It Such A Problem????

Robots in social media?!? Social media is the general public construct of the digital world. Every person that engages on a social media platform wishes to see what the latest news, celebs, their good friends, as well as influencers are up too. Most wish to be a star on their platform of choice, as well as the only method to achieve information that just applies to their world. Yet, just like anything, there is one huge concern that maintains developing, robots. Although Twitter, Instagram, and also Facebook all have actually attempted to get this issue controlled, it’s a continuous concern that remains to this day, and it could be affecting you and your business.

Robots in social media do cost you money

If you have ever before reviewed records about Instagram and parent company Facebook’s advertisement profits, you’ll know that there are billions of dollars involved. With such a successful business, financiers need to make sure that their money is well spent. After their development, social media sites systems saw a surge in fake accounts. These accounts are referred to as “bots” short for robots. They come from a person, yet they are being ran by software. The software program is usually programmed to manage the social media accounts to gain access to social network’s markets. When the robot has actually gained access to the users chosen market. The owner of the bot can start interacting with the market. Generally to market products or feed information to persuade the market to certainly start purchasing product or believing an idea like “Someone is not a con-man”. The software program is usually worked on a cloud web server with proxy web addresses or simply any computer system linked to the net. Making it very difficult for Facebook to figure out where the Robot is working from. They are valuable in quantity rather than the quality of material they upload. How to spot a Robot

Frequently robot accounts have no or one message as well as a link in the bio directing them to an outside site or another account. Their primary use is to follow and like your content. These accounts aid to get genuine users to click over to their account or to an exterior website. They are a bit spammy and also social networks’s second-worst problem only behind a security information violation. For individuals, they are just annoyances, but also for advertisers, they create a negative Return On Investment.
Although the social networks titans have actually fought on these accounts, there hasn’t been an obvious decrease in the number of bots. It is easy for a user to take a look at an account as well as determine signs that it is a robot account.

    They robots if:

  • 1. There isn’t an account picture
  • 2. User names are a mix of numbers as well as letter that do not form words
  • 3. There are hardly any type of photos

What about Influencers

If you are partnering with an influencer. Ensure that they have genuine accounts in their follower’s list. If you scroll through the followers or fans of an account and also you see any one of the indicators discussed above, be concerned. Their following is made up of phony accounts, not real people. An additional way to assess the credibility of their target market is to have a look at their interaction price by comparing their number of fans to the number of likes as well as remarks they obtain. If a lot of their comments originate from bots, they will certainly be common introductions like, “Good post” and also “Trendy feed” complied with by emojis. They normally don’t reference specifics and also in some cases lead you to one more page or direct you to a web link. A typical involvement price should be around 3%, and a superb price typically hovers around the 6% mark. Although these numbers seem low, they are regular on social networks.
